Hub clinics
Hub clinics are run by the Western Sussex Hospital Trust and
include:
- Sexually transmitted infection diagnosis and treatment
(including Chlamydia).
- HIV diagnosis.
- General contraception including Long-Acting Reversible
Contraception (LARC) methods by appointment.
- Emergency contraception.
- Pregnancy testing.
- Refferal to Termination of Pregnancy (ToP) services.
- Psychosexual counselling by appointment.
- Sexual health advice.
- Free condoms.
Walk-in and appointment clinics are Monday to Friday between
9.00am and 7.00pm and Saturday mornings.

Spoke Clinics
Spoke clinics are run by the Western Sussex Hospital Trust and
include:
- Chlamydia screening and treatment.
- Pregnancy testing.
- Access to Termination of Pregnancy (ToP) services.
- General contraception including Long-Acting Reversible
Contraception (LARC) methods by appointment.
- Emergency contraception.
- Sexual health advice.
- Free condoms.

Outreach clinics
Outreach clinics are where a nurse from the Western Sussex
Hospital Trust go into a centre for a couple of hours a week and
include:
- Contraception and advice.
- Emergency Hormonal Contraception.
- Chlamydia screening.
- Pregnancy testing anf referral.
- Sexual health advice.
- Free condoms.

Psychosexual Counselling
Psychosexual therapy for a range of sexual issues such as:
- Difficulties with erection, ejaculation, orgasm, desire
etc.
- Sexual trauma or pain.
- Sexual functioning and ill health, disability etc.
Referrals are from health professionals, e.g. GPs, nurses,
health advisors, other doctors.
